Rosalie LESAGE was born 13 August 1745 in L'Assomption, Canada, New France
Rosalie LESAGE was the child of Jean-Baptiste LESAGE and Therese GAUDRY and the grandchild of: (paternal) Jean Bernardin LESAGE dit LEPIEDMONTOIS and Marie-Barbe SYLVESTRE (maternal) Jacques GAUDRY dit BOURBONNIERE and Anne BOURDONSpouse(s)/Partner(s) and Child(ren):
Rosalie married Joseph AUGER 5 July 1763 in L'Assomption, Province of Québec, Canada . The couple had (at least) 1 child.
Joseph AUGER was born abt. 1735 in Lotbinière, Québec, Canada (Saint-Louis). Joseph died 26 December 1809 in L'Assomption, Québec, Canada (St-Pierre-du-Portage). Joseph was the child of Joseph AUGER and Elisabeth MAILLOT.
Rosalie LESAGE died 19 December 1809 in L'Assomption, Lower Canada .

From its inception in the early 1600s until 1760, it was called Canada, New France.
1760 to 1763, it was simply Canada
1763 to 1791 - Province of Québec
1791 to 1867 - Lower Canada
1867 to present - Québec, Canada.
